Text
(1)Proceedings for inclusion within a district territory adjacent thereto and located wholly within another district may be initiated by:
(a)A petition for inclusion filed with the directors of the district within which the territory is proposed to be included, signed by 25 or two-thirds, whichever is the lesser, of the landowners of the adjacent territory; or
(b)Resolutions for inclusion adopted by the board of directors of each district to be affected by the inclusion and filed with the State Department of Agriculture.
